2005 Canadian Cyclocross National Championships

September 22, 2005 – The Canadian Cyclocross National Championships return to Ontario for 2005. This year’s event will take place at Hardwood Hills just outside of Barrie Ontario. Hardwood Hills has a long history of hosting National level Mountain Bike and Cross Country skiing events. This years Championship will be organized by one of Ontario’s Top cyclocross organizers and with the assistance of the Hardwood Hills staff, it’s sure to be the best Championships yet.

The redesigned course for 2005 is sure to challenge the best cross riders in the country. Each lap riders will test themselves over a fast 3km circuit with three run-ups, two sets of Barriers and a fast sandy descent.

The 2005 Canadian Cyclocross Championships are open to Canadian Citizens with valid UCI licenses that show a “CAN” in front of their license number. Riders in all Championship Categories must use Cyclocross bicycles. A Challenge category has been formed to accommodate U13, U15, U17 riders and Male and female riders using Mountain Bikes or cross bikes (open to riders with Ontario citizen’s permits) 1 Event permits will not be sold.
